Output e59ba32c4cac106539c7b4b9053607bd8bfb441fbb1f5c5713ba5c857a8be28e:1

value
2657010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b18d4b639c11d2017a6b6effecfde2480afc20b OP_EQUALVERIFY OP_CHECKSIG
address
14vsoXkqJJUktidwxSNus9MMWu4V1Pjkse
transaction
e59ba32c4cac106539c7b4b9053607bd8bfb441fbb1f5c5713ba5c857a8be28e
confirmations
479738
spent
true